Portola, CA 96125 Frost Dates
Frost dates for Portola, CA, ZIP 96125
Around 05/12 is the usual last spring frost, about 257 days away. The first fall frost typically arrives around 10/29, about 167 frost-free days later.
Portola sits in USDA Zone 7a (0 to 5°F average annual minimum). The dates above are NOAA's 1991-2020 normal at the nearest reporting station, a 30-year average, not a forecast.

Why 05/12 isn't a guarantee
05/12 is the middle of 30 years of NOAA records, not a promise. Plant by 04/22 and you're betting against frost in roughly 9 years out of 10. 06/02 is the safer bet, historically only a 1-in-10 chance of frost that late.
